How does life coaching for advanced practice providers reduce burnout?

Advanced practice providers (APPs) are vital to modern healthcare systems. These dedicated professionals, nurse practitioners, physician assistants, certified nurse midwives, and clinical nurse specialists deliver essential care while often experiencing overwhelming demands and stress. The healthcare industry continues to witness concerning rates of burnout among these valuable providers, affecting both personal well-being and patient outcomes. 

Burnout challenge in healthcare

The daily reality for many APPs involves mounting paperwork, high patient loads, complex cases, and administrative burdens, all while maintaining compassionate care. Statistics reveal that over half of APPs report symptoms of burnout, including emotional exhaustion, depersonalization, and diminished sense of accomplishment.  Experience burnout, healthcare organizations face significant costs related to recruitment, on boarding new providers, and temporary coverage. The personal toll on these professionals can include:

  • Sleep disturbances and chronic fatigue
  • Increased risk of depression and anxiety
  • Relationship difficulties and social withdrawal
  • Physical symptoms, including headaches and digestive issues
  • Reduced job satisfaction and questioning career choices

Personalized support

Traditional wellness programs often fall short by focusing solely on individual resilience without addressing systemic issues. Effective interventions must recognize both personal and organizational factors contributing to burnout. This is where specialized coaching emerges as a powerful solution. Coaching creates a confidential space for professionals to process challenges, identify patterns, and develop strategies aligned with personal values. Unlike generalized approaches, coaching tailors support each provider’s unique circumstances and goals.

Sustainable practices through coaching

Structured coaching sessions help APPs establish boundaries between professional and personal life. These sessions guide providers in assessing workload, managing time effectively, and communicating needs assertively within healthcare teams. The coaching relationship fosters accountability through regular check-ins, helping providers implement and refine strategies over time. This ongoing support proves particularly valuable during periods of high stress or organizational change.

Rediscovering purpose and meaning

Many APPs initially chose healthcare careers motivated by deep purpose and commitment to helping others. Burnout can obscure this foundational motivation. Life and Career Coaching for Physicians and APPs helps providers reconnect with core values and rediscover meaning in daily practice.

Coaches support APPs in identifying aspects of work that generate fulfilment and energy. This process often involves reflecting on patient interactions that proved particularly meaningful or skills that bring professional satisfaction. By reconnecting with these elements, providers can intentionally incorporate more fulfilling activities into their schedules.

Implementing coaching in healthcare settings

Healthcare organizations increasingly recognize coaching’s value in comprehensive wellness strategies. Effective implementation involves several key elements:

  • Executive leadership support and resource commitment
  • Clear communication about coaching benefits and confidentiality
  • Flexible scheduling allowing providers to engage fully
  • Selection of coaches with healthcare background or specific APP experience
  • Objective metrics to evaluate program effectiveness
